Runnymede and Weybridge
2015 General Election · 7 May 2015 · England
Philip Hammond (Conservative) won the seat, a Con hold, with a majority of 22,134 on a 67.8% turnout.
Electorate 73,771 · Valid votes 50,052 · Turnout 67.8%
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|
| Philip Hammond (sitting MP) | Conservative | 29,901 | 59.7% |
| Arran Neathey | Labour | 7,767 | 15.5% |
| Joe Branco | UK Independence Party | 6,951 | 13.9% |
| John Vincent | Liberal Democrat | 3,362 | 6.7% |
| Rustam Majainah | Green Party | 2,071 | 4.1% |
